当前位置: 首页> 黑客网> 正文

IIS文件解析漏洞影响范围

IIS文件解析漏洞是Web服务器安全领域的一个重要问题,它涉及到IIS服务器对HTTP请求处理不当,导致将非可执行的脚本文件等当做可执行的脚本文件等执行。该漏洞可能导致攻击者获取服务器权限,对系统造成危害。

影响范围概述

IIS文件解析漏洞影响范围

IIS文件解析漏洞的影响范围主要包括以下几个方面:

1. 文件上传功能:许多Web应用程序具有文件上传功能,如在论坛上发布图片,在个人网站上发布压缩包等。如果这些应用程序没有对上传文件的格式进行严格过滤,就有可能存在文件上传漏洞。攻击者可以通过文件上传漏洞,上传包含恶意代码的文件,并通过后续的代码执行来获取服务器权限。

2. 特定后缀名的文件解析:在IIS6.0环境下,服务器默认会将某些特定后缀名的文件(如.asp、.asa、.cer等)解析为可执行的脚本文件。这意味着攻击者只需上传具有这些后缀名的文件,即可利用文件解析漏洞来执行恶意代码。

3. 目录解析漏洞:在IIS6.0中,如果在网站下建立了一个文件夹,其名称中带有.asp、.asa等可执行脚本文件的后缀,那么该文件夹内的任何扩展名的文件都将被IIS当作可执行文件来解析并执行。这种目录解析漏洞为攻击者提供了额外的攻击途径。

4. 特殊字符绕过:攻击者还可以利用特殊字符(如分号)来绕过服务器的一些安全检查。例如,在文件名中添加分号,可以使服务器忽略分号后面的内容,从而达到上传恶意代码的目的。

防御措施

为了减轻IIS文件解析漏洞的影响,可以采取以下防御措施:

1. 升级IIS版本:将IIS版本升级至最新版,以修复旧版本中存在的安全漏洞。

2. 限制上传文件大小:设置上传文件大小的限制,防止大文件导致拒绝服务攻击。

3. 重命名用户上传的文件:在服务器端重命名用户上传的文件,以杜绝上传时的文件名攻击。

4. 过滤恶意文件:在客户端或服务器端对上传的文件进行严格的格式检查和过滤,避免恶意文件的上传。

5. 配置Web服务器:合理配置Web服务器的各项参数,如限制处理程序映射、关闭不必要的服务等。

6. 使用其他Web服务器软件:考虑使用Apache等其他Web服务器软件替代IIS,以避免利用IIS特有的漏洞。

综上所述,IIS文件解析漏洞的影响范围相当广泛,它不仅影响到Web应用程序的安全性,还可能导致整个服务器系统的不稳定。因此,采取有效的防御措施对于保护Web服务器免受此类漏洞的侵害至关重要。